The poetry of Mildmay Fane, second Earl of Westmorland : from the Fulbeck, Harvard, and Westmorland manuscripts

This body of poetry establishes Mildmay Fane as a significant early modern poet rather than as a patron and the author of a slim volume of poems. From his privileged position near the centre of the conflict, he confronted a climactic and influential sequence of events, the English civil war.
